Regarding sizing, and I'm sorry I didn't think to mention it above, I wear a size 9 in athletic shoes but an 8 in Oofos. The 9 didn't hit my arch right. My daughter wears a 9-9 1/2 in athletic shoes and she wears an Oofos size 10. So eventmom if for some reason the ones you ordered don't fit, you may need to adjust a size up or down to get what works for you.
